Abstract:

Significant advances in software engineering practices and computational techniques necessitate modernizing foundational astrodynamics software. The routines originally released in 1999 have been updated and migrated to an open-source GitHub repository. This collection, primarily in C#, MATLAB, Python, C++, and Fortran, supports essential astrodynamics calculations. The modernization aims to establish a robust, source-controlled codebase, create a packageable library for easy integration, and implement modern practices like automated testing and documentation. By fostering a collaborative open-source environment, we aim to build a shared library that evolves with community needs and reduces the redundancy of developing similar tools independently.
